Spring Hues and Pastel Delights

Easter is synonymous with the soft pastels of springtime: think blooming lavender, baby blues, and sunny yellows. These hues create an ethereal and delicate look that complements floral and Easter-themed designs perfectly. Paint your nails a soft lavender shade and add white daisies for a touch of charm, or opt for a pastel yellow base and paint tiny bunnies frolicking in a grassy meadow. Egg-cellent Nail Art

Eggs are a quintessential symbol of Easter, and they make for adorable nail art subjects. Paint your nails in a soft white shade and add colorful stripes or polka dots to create the illusion of tiny speckled eggs. You can also draw intricate patterns on larger eggs for a more sophisticated look. For a touch of whimsy, try painting a few eggs with bunny ears or chick faces.

Floral Festivities

Spring is the season of blooming flowers, so why not bring that beauty to your nails? Paint tiny violets or daisies in pastel shades, or create a blooming meadow on your tips with a variety of floral designs. If you’re feeling adventurous, try negative space nail art to let the natural color of your nails peek through the floral patterns.

2. What nail shape is best for Easter nails?

Oval or squoval shapes are versatile and complement most designs.

3. How can I create bunny nail art?

Paint a white base, and use a thin brush to outline a bunny shape. Fill it in with pink or light blue. Add details like ears, eyes, and whiskers.

4. How do I paint egg nail art?

Paint a yellow or white base, and use a round brush to create the egg shape. Add details like a crack or pattern.

5. Can I use glitter or rhinestones on Easter nails?

Yes, they can add sparkle and depth to your design, but use them sparingly to avoid overpowering the design.

6. How to make flower nail art?

Use a dotting tool or a thin brush to create petals by dabbing or stroking in different colors. Add details like a dot in the center.
